Last Chance

Showings of film and an exhibition of photography which responds to televised sport. With the Commonwealth Games looming, and the dubious sounding 'eyes of the world upon us', it seems a smart choice to host a show of work which picks up on the thrills 'n' spills of 'the spectacle', ie. social, public events. Of course, the Romans, and later the French, had perfected 'the spectacle' - each in their inimitable ways. Still, neither empire had TV, nor its multiple camera angles, pundits and stats ... and this show grapples with some technology too. Work by Tracey Moffat, Julie Henry, Mark Lewis, Roderick Buchanan, Ravi Deepres.

Spectator sport is at Cornerhouse until Sunday, June 23.
